There are two issues on creating custom heads - you want your own "custom" morph shapes and you want a good skin texture. But, honestly, I wonder what the point of using these are. ![]() None of the faces you posted really has those kinds of issues because they are either younger or less detailed men. ![]() It's really the older people (and men) who need those wrinkles and other details to look great. ![]() Also, younger people and women in particular look fine at 1K. The biggest issue with lower than 4K is a "softness" but that can work to its advantage at times, particularly if you are going for a toonier look. Īs a very general rule you would want at least 2K for your photos for really good quality heads, but I have done famous folks at lower res (1K) and gotten decent results (it helps that we recognize the famous).
